Course Details

• Data Acquisition and Management: This unit will cover strategies for acquiring and managing large sets of health data, including data from electronic health records, clinical trials, and medical devices. Emphasis will be placed on data security, privacy, and interoperability.

• Data Analytics and Visualization: This unit will teach participants how to analyze and visualize health data using statistical methods and data visualization tools. Participants will learn how to extract insights from data and communicate those insights effectively to stakeholders.

• Machine Learning and AI in Healthcare: This unit will explore the role of machine learning and artificial intelligence in healthcare, including the use of predictive analytics, natural language processing, and computer vision. Participants will learn about the latest advances in these technologies and how to apply them to health data.

• Healthcare Policy and Regulation: This unit will provide an overview of healthcare policy and regulation related to health data, including data privacy laws, HIPAA, and GDPR. Participants will learn about the ethical considerations related to health data and how to navigate the regulatory landscape.

• Health Data Governance and Leadership: This unit will cover best practices for health data governance and leadership, including the development of data governance strategies, the establishment of data governance committees, and the implementation of data governance policies. Participants will learn how to lead and manage teams of data professionals in the healthcare industry.

• Health Data Security and Privacy: This unit will focus on health data security and privacy, including the implementation of security protocols, the management of cybersecurity risks, and the protection of patient data. Participants will learn about the latest threats to health data security and how to mitigate those threats.

• Health Data Integration and Interoperability: This unit will teach participants how to integrate and make health data interoperable across different systems, platforms, and devices. Participants will learn about the latest standards and frameworks for health data interoperability.

Career Path

In the UK, the health data sector is booming, creating a high demand for professionals with specialized skills in health data. Here are some top roles in this field and their respective market share, visualized through a 3D pie chart. 1. **Data Scientist (30%):** A data scientist in health care leverages data mining, machine learning, and statistical analysis to extract insights from health data. They design and implement models, algorithms, and predictive analytics that improve patient outcomes. 2. **Health Data Analyst (25%):** A health data analyst collects, analyzes, and interprets complex health data sets to identify trends and patterns. Their work supports decision-making in healthcare organizations, ensuring better patient care and improved operational efficiency. 3. **Clinical Data Manager (20%):** A clinical data manager specializes in managing clinical trials' data, from design to implementation and analysis. They ensure data integrity, regulatory compliance, and quality control throughout the trial process. 4. **Health Informatician (15%):** A health informatician focuses on integrating health data with technology to improve healthcare delivery and outcomes. They design, develop, and maintain health IT systems, creating solutions to manage and analyze data effectively. 5. **Business Intelligence Developer (10%):** A business intelligence developer utilizes data analytics and visualization techniques to provide actionable insights to healthcare organizations. They create and maintain databases, data systems, and tools to support data-driven decision-making.
